The Vice President of Procurement is a key executive responsible for leading all sourcing, supplier management, and procurement strategy. This role ensures supply continuity, cost competitiveness, and strong supplier partnerships across a highly cyclical, price-sensitive, and supply-constrained industry.

The VP of Procurement will play a critical role in protecting gross margin, improving inventory turns, and strengthening supply resilience across core product categories such as HVAC, and related building materials.

Core Responsibilities

Enterprise Procurement Strategy

  • Develop and execute a category-based procurement strategy aligned with revenue growth and margin expansion goals
  • Build sourcing strategies that account for commodity volatility and industry demand cycles
  • Align procurement priorities with branch operations, sales forecasts, and customer demand patterns

Supplier & Vendor Management

  • Manage relationships with domestic and international suppliers across key building product categories
  • Negotiate pricing agreements, rebates, and volume incentives
  • Establish and maintain preferred supplier programs and strategic partnerships
  • Diversify the supply base to reduce dependency on single-source or constrained suppliers
  • Conduct regular supplier business reviews and performance evaluations

Cost Management & Margin Optimization

  • Drive gross margin improvement through disciplined buying and price management
  • Monitor product markets and adjust sourcing strategies accordingly
  • Lead annual cost-down initiatives and rebate optimization programs
  • Partner with Finance and Sales to ensure pricing alignment and margin discipline across branches

Inventory & Supply Chain Coordination

  • Work closely with Operations to balance service levels with inventory investment
  • Reduce stockouts, backorders, and excess inventory through improved supplier reliability and forecasting alignment
  • Improve inventory turns while maintaining high service levels
  • Support the branch network with allocation strategies during constrained supply periods

Risk Management & Supply Continuity

  • Develop contingency sourcing strategies for high-demand or constrained materials
  • Monitor global supply chain disruptions impacting building materials availability and pricing
  • Implement supplier risk assessments and mitigation plans
  • Ensure continuity of supply during peak construction seasons and market shortages

Leadership & Team Development

  • Lead and develop a procurement team by establishing clear KPIs
  • Build a high-performance, data-driven procurement organization
  • Foster collaboration between Procurement, Sales, Operations, and branch leadership

Systems & Process Improvement

  • Optimize procurement systems, including ERP platforms, pricing tools, and supplier portals
  • Improve purchase order workflows, approval processes, and spend visibility
  • Leverage analytics to improve demand forecasting and supplier performance tracking
  • Drive automation and standardization across procurement processes
